×

revenir sur ses pas meaning in English

v. double back, retrace one's path

Related Words

  1. revenir
  2. revenir de
  3. revenir sur
  4. faire revenir
  5. revenir à
  6. revenir bredouille
  7. revenir à soi
  8. revenir tout droit
  9. revenir en place brusquement
  10. revenir à la mémoire
  11. revenir sur sa promesse
  12. revenir sur sa parole
  13. revenir sur une décision
  14. revenir tout droit
PC Version

Copyright © 2018 WordTech Co.